Customizing WordPress navigation menus
Try MaxiBlocks for free with 500+ library assets including basic templates. No account required. Free page builder, theme and updates included. Start now
Key takeaways:
- Navigate to Appearance > Menus in the WordPress dashboard to create and manage navigation menus.
- Add various types of links to menus, organize them into a hierarchy, and apply them to different locations on your site.
- Customizing WordPress navigation menus through the Customizer for better branding.
- Plugins like MaxiBlocks offer advanced features, including sticky menus and buttons.
Your WordPress menu: A quick guide
WordPress menus are essential for easy site navigation, allowing visitors to find what they’re looking for. From creating a new menu to customizing its appearance and adding advanced features with plugins, this guide covers the essentials of customizing WordPress navigation menus.
How can I customize WordPress navigation menus?
Customizing WordPress Navigation Menus, start by accessing the Menus screen under Appearance > Menus in your dashboard. Here, you can create a new menu and add items like pages, posts, custom links, and categories. Organize these items into a hierarchy by dragging and arranging them, potentially creating submenus under broader categories. To further customize the appearance, such as changing colors or fonts, use the WordPress Customizer found under Appearance > Customize. For additional functionality like sticky menus or adding buttons, consider using plugins like MaxiBlocks.
A beginner’s guide to customizing WordPress navigation menus
WordPress lets you build awesome websites, and navigation menus are key to making it easy for people to find stuff. Whether you’re totally new to WordPress or making some updates, knowing how to work with menus is important. They help your site look good and help visitors get around.Â
Understanding WordPress navigation menus
WordPress menus are the primary tool visitors use to navigate your site’s content. They’re typically located at the top of your site, but depending on your theme, they can also be found on the side or at the bottom. WordPress allows you to create multiple menus, enabling different navigation structures for different sections of your site.
Creating a new menu
- Access the menus screen: From your WordPress dashboard, navigate to Appearance > Menus.
- Create a new menu: Click on “create a new menu” at the top of the page. Name your menu in the Menu Name box and click “Create Menu.”
Adding items to your menu
Once your menu is created, you can start adding items to it. WordPress allows you to add various types of links to your menus, including:
- Pages: Links to your site’s pages.
- Posts: Links to your latest blog posts.
- Custom links: Links to external sites or specific sections within your site.
- Categories: Links to post categories.
To add an item, simply select it from the left-hand side of the Menus screen and click “Add to Menu.”
Organizing your menu
After adding items to your menu, you can organize them by dragging and dropping them into place. You can create a hierarchy by dragging an item slightly to the right of another item, making it a submenu. This is useful for organizing related content under a broader category.
Applying your menu to your site
Once you’re satisfied with your menu’s structure, you need to assign it to a location on your site. These locations are defined by your WordPress theme and can include areas like the primary navigation bar, footer, or sidebar. Select the desired location from the “Menu Settings” section at the bottom of the Menus screen and click “Save Menu.”
Customizing WordPress navigation menus
While the basic functionality of WordPress menus is the same across all themes, their appearance can vary significantly. Many themes offer additional customization options for menus, such as changing colours, fonts, and layout. These options are usually found in the Customizer (Appearance > Customize), allowing you to preview changes in real time.
Advanced Customizing WordPress navigation menus with a plugin
If you need more advanced features, such as mega menus or fully responsive mobile menus, several WordPress plugins can help. Plugins like “Max Mega Menu” or “Responsive Menu” offer extensive customization options, giving you the ability to create complex navigation structures without coding.
Customizing your WordPress navigation menus is a straightforward process that can have a significant impact on your site’s usability and aesthetic appeal. By following the steps outlined in this guide, you’ll be able to create a navigation structure that enhances your visitors’ experience and reflects your site’s content and style. Remember, a well-designed menu not only helps visitors explore your site but also contributes to a professional and polished online presence.
FAQs: Customizing WordPress navigation menus
How do I start creating a simple WordPress navigation menu?
Begin by going to your WordPress dashboard, then navigate to Appearance > Menus. Here, you can create a new menu by naming it and adding pages, categories, or custom links. Keeping your menu simple and intuitive is key to a good user experience.
What are some tips for adding and managing submenus effectively?
To add a submenu, drag the desired item slightly to the right under the main menu item in the menu editor. Keep your submenus logical and organized, ensuring they directly relate to the parent menu item for a smoother navigation experience.
How can I customize the appearance of my navigation menu for better branding?
Use the Customizer under Appearance in your WordPress dashboard to tweak colours, fonts, and other styles. For more advanced customization, consider using custom CSS or plugins that offer additional styling options.
What are the crucial elements of an effective WordPress navigation menu?
An effective WordPress menu is intuitive, accessible, and well-structured. It should align with the user’s expectations, be easy to use on all devices, and guide them to important sections without overwhelming them with choices.
How has website navigation evolved, and what does this mean for WordPress sites?
Website navigation has shifted from simple text links to dynamic, interactive menus that adapt to user behavior and device type. For WordPress sites, this means utilizing themes and plugins that support responsive and adaptive menus.
Why is designing responsive navigation menus for mobile devices important?
With the increasing use of mobile devices to access the internet, having a menu that adjusts to different screen sizes is essential to provide a consistent user experience across all devices.
Can you explain the psychology behind navigation menu design?
Navigation design influences how users interact with your website. A well-designed menu can reduce cognitive load by making it easier for users to find what they need, thereby improving overall satisfaction.
What’s the role of mega menus in enhancing e-commerce websites?
Mega menus display a large number of options at once, allowing e-commerce sites to showcase various categories and products, making it easier for users to browse the selection without navigating away from the main page.
How do I make my WordPress navigation menus accessible?
Focus on keyboard navigation, proper ARIA labels, and ensuring your menu works well with screen readers. WordPress themes that follow accessibility standards can also help.
What are some navigation menu trends for WordPress websites?
Current trends include the use of fullscreen menus, sticky navigation bars, mega menus for complex sites, and minimalist menus for simpler sites. Keeping abreast of these trends can help your site stand out.
What are the benefits of customizing WordPress navigation menus?
Customizing WordPress navigation menus allows you to create a more user-friendly and visually appealing site. Tailored menus can improve navigation, making it easier for visitors to find key content, which can increase engagement and reduce bounce rates. Additionally, customized menus can better reflect your brand’s identity and enhance the overall user experience.
How can I start customizing WordPress navigation menus on my site?
You can start customizing WordPress navigation menus by accessing the WordPress Dashboard and navigating to Appearance > Menus. From here, you can create new menus, add or remove menu items, and arrange them in the desired order. WordPress also allows you to customize menus by adding custom links, categories, and even pages.
Can I add custom links when customizing WordPress navigation menus?
Yes, you can add custom links when customizing WordPress navigation menus. In the Menus section of your WordPress Dashboard, there is an option to add custom links. Simply enter the URL and the link text, then add it to your menu. This feature is useful for linking to external sites or specific pages within your site.
Are there plugins available for further customizing WordPress navigation menus?
Absolutely, there are several plugins available for further customizing WordPress navigation menus. Plugins like Max Mega Menu, WP Mega Menu, and UberMenu offer advanced customization options, including mega menus, drag-and-drop builders, and additional styling features. These plugins can enhance the functionality and appearance of your navigation menus.
How do I customize the appearance of navigation menus when customizing WordPress navigation menus?
To customize the appearance of navigation menus when customizing WordPress navigation menus, you can use the built-in Customizer found under Appearance > Customise. Here, you can adjust the menu’s colours, fonts, and layout. For more advanced styling, you can add custom CSS under Additional CSS in the Customizer or use a theme that supports extensive menu styling options.
What are some best practices for using dropdown menus?
Ensure dropdown menus are easy to activate, don’t disappear too quickly, and are accessible for keyboard and screen reader users. Also, avoid too many nested layers that can confuse users.
How do I style a navigation bar in WordPress?
To style a navigation bar in WordPress, you can use the WordPress Customizer under Appearance > Customize. Navigate to the “Menus” section to access your menu settings, and then use the “Additional CSS” section to apply custom styles. You can also use a theme or plugin that provides advanced menu styling options.
How do I add custom items to my WordPress menu?
To add custom items to your WordPress menu, go to Appearance > Menus in your WordPress dashboard. Select the menu you want to edit, then use the “Custom Links” option to add custom URLs. Enter the URL and link text, then click “Add to Menu” and arrange the item as needed.
How to create a dynamic menu in WordPress?
To create a dynamic menu in WordPress, use plugins like Conditional Menus or Nav Menu Roles, which allow you to show or hide menu items based on user roles, conditions, or other criteria. These plugins provide options to create menus that change dynamically based on the user or context.
How do I customize my WordPress dashboard menu?
To customize your WordPress dashboard menu, you can use plugins like Admin Menu Editor. This plugin allows you to rearrange, hide, or rename items in the dashboard menu. You can also add custom items to the admin menu using the plugin’s interface.
How do I customize navigation buttons?
To customize navigation buttons in WordPress, use the WordPress Customizer or a plugin that provides button styling options. You can add custom CSS to change the appearance of buttons, including their color, size, padding, and hover effects.
How do I change the appearance of the menu in WordPress?
To change the appearance of the menu in WordPress, navigate to Appearance > Customize > Menus. Here, you can modify menu settings and use the “Additional CSS” section to apply custom styles. You can also use themes or plugins that offer menu customization features for more advanced styling options.
How do I change the navigation menu font in WordPress?
To change the navigation menu font in WordPress, you can use the WordPress Customizer under Appearance > Customize > Additional CSS to add custom CSS for font styling. Alternatively, use a plugin like Easy Google Fonts to easily change fonts throughout your site, including the navigation menu.
How do I customize my toolbar in WordPress?
To customize your toolbar in WordPress, you can use plugins like Adminimize or WP Custom Admin Interface. These plugins allow you to add, remove, or rearrange items in the WordPress toolbar, making it more suited to your workflow and preferences.
How do I create a custom menu and submenu in WordPress?
To create a custom menu and submenu in WordPress, go to Appearance > Menus in your WordPress dashboard. Create a new menu or select an existing one, then add menu items. To create a submenu, drag and drop a menu item slightly to the right under another menu item, creating a nested structure.
How do I add a custom field to my menu in WordPress?
To add a custom field to your menu in WordPress, you can use the Advanced Custom Fields (ACF) plugin along with some custom coding. ACF allows you to create custom fields for menu items, and you can display these fields by modifying your theme’s menu template.
How to create a custom menu widget in WordPress?
To create a custom menu widget in WordPress, go to Appearance > Widgets and add the “Navigation Menu” widget to your desired widget area. Select the menu you want to display from the dropdown list and customize its appearance using widget settings or additional CSS for styling.
How can I create a sticky menu with MaxiBlocks?
MaxiBlocks is a plugin that allows you to create sticky menus easily. Once installed, you can add a new block in your header area and select the ‘Sticky’ option to ensure your navigation stays visible as users scroll.What’s the benefit of adding a button to my MaxiBlocks menu?
Adding a button in your footer menu, such as a call-to-action (CTA) or a menu toggle, can improve navigation by providing a clear, clickable element that stands out, encouraging users to take desired actions.
WordPress itself
Official Website
wordpress.org – This is the official website for WordPress, where you can download the software, find documentation, and learn more about using it.
WordPress Codex
codex.wordpress.org/Main_Page – This is a comprehensive documentation resource for WordPress, covering everything from installation and configuration to specific functionality and troubleshooting.
WordPress Theme DirectoryÂ
wordpress.org/themes – The official WordPress theme directory is a great place to find free and premium WordPress themes. You can browse themes by category, feature, and popularity.
maxiblocks.com/go/help-desk
maxiblocks.com/pro-library
www.youtube.com/@maxiblocks
twitter.com/maxiblocks
linkedin.com/company/maxi-blocks
github.com/orgs/maxi-blocks
wordpress.org/plugins/maxi-blocks